FINDINGS AND CONCLUSIONS: The findings and conclusions on which the Planning Director <br />based the decision are noted below. <br />The subject parcel is located within the Salem Urban Growth Boundary (UGB), designated <br />Single Family Residential in the Salem Area Comprehensive Plan, and zoned UD (Urban <br />Development). The UD (URBAN DEVELOPMENT) zone is under the jurisdiction of <br />Marion County. <br />2. The subject parcel is located at the southwest corner of Hayesville Drive and Reimann Street <br />NE. The property contains three single-family dwellings and accessory structures. <br />3. Properties to the east are zoned UD and consist of various sized lots containing single-family <br />dwellings. Properties to the north, south, and west are zoned RS and developed as single- <br />family subdivisions. <br />4. The applicants propose to divide a 24,393 square foot parcels into 3 lots containing 6,000 <br />square feet, 6,000 square feet, and 12,393 square feet each. An existing dwelling will remain <br />on each of the proposed lots all of which will front on Hayesville Drive. The subject <br />property is described by deed recorded on May 17, 1973 prior to adoption of County <br />ordinances requiring a review of land divisions of this type. The property is considered a <br />legal parcel for land use purposes. <br />5. Marion County Public Works issued comments as follows: <br />STREETS <br />In accordance with Marion County Driveway Ordinance #651, if this partition is approved, <br />the applicant will be required to apply for driveway "Access Permits" for any future <br />revision(s) to existing accesses to proposed parcels #1, #2 & #3. Driveways must meet sight <br />distance, design, spacing, and safety standards. <br />The existing gravel driveway on Hayesville Drive NE serving the parent parcel (proposed <br />parcel #3) shall be closed. Access to parcel 43 shall continue to be from the existing access <br />to Reimann Avenue NE, as depicted on the application tentative site plan. If and when <br />access to Reimann Street NE is redone as part of redevelopment, one and only one access <br />would be approved. <br />Frontage improvements are not required at this time. However, if and when redevelopment <br />on the subject property were to occur, the applicant will be required to improve Hayesville <br />Drive NE and Reimann Street NE along their property frontage to City of Salem standards as <br />directed by the Marion County Public Works Department. This will include such elements <br />as providing a 17 -foot paved half -width (Hayesville Drive NE only) and transition taper, curb <br />and gutter, property line sidewalk, ADA sidewalk ramp at the corner of Hayesville Drive NE <br />and Reimann Street NE., through -curb drains and landscaping. Engineered plans must be <br />submitted and approved by the Marion County Public Works Department prior to <br />construction permit issuance. <br />
